Investigation on the Possible Electric Field Effect and Surface Morphology of a YBCO/CeO_2/Au MIS Diode (Special Issue on High-Temperature Superconducting Electronics)

A YBCO / CeO_2 / Au MIS structure (YBCO:YBa_2Cu_3O_<7-y>) is fabricated on a MgO(100) substrate with the help of the all-in-situ electron-beam and heater coevaperation system. The current-voltage (I-V) characteristics of the deposited YBCO film under various gate voltages are examined. Small modulation of the I-V characteristics by gate voltages can be observed. Meanwhile, the surface morphology is also studied by means of an atomic force microscope (AFM). The relation between the field effect and the surface morphology of a thin YBCO film is discussed.
